The1962 Australian Drivers' Championship was aCAMS sanctioned motor racing title for drivers[1] ofFormula Libre racing cars.[2] The winner of the title, which was the sixthAustralian Drivers' Championship, was awarded the 1962 CAMS Gold Star.[1]
The championship was won byBib Stillwell driving aCooper T53Coventry Climax FPF.
The championship was contested over a six race series.[3]
| Round[4] | Race name[4] | Circuit[4] | State | Date[4] | Winning driver[4] | Car[4] | Entrant[4] |
| 1 | South Pacific Championship[5] | Longford | Tasmania | 5 March | John Surtees | Cooper T53Coventry Climax | Bowmaker - Yeoman Credit[5] |
| 2 | Craven A Bathurst 100[6] | Mount Panorama Circuit,Bathurst[6] | New South Wales | 23 April | Bib Stillwell | Cooper T53Coventry Climax | B. S. Stillwell |
| 3 | Queensland Road Race Championship | Lowood | Queensland | 3 June | Greg Cusack | Cooper T51Coventry Climax | Scuderia Veloce |
| 4 | Victorian Road Racing Championship | Sandown Park | Victoria | 16 September | Lex Davison | Cooper T53Coventry Climax | Ecurie Australie |
| 5 | Advertiser Trophy | Mallala | South Australia | 8 October | Bib Stillwell | Cooper T53Coventry Climax | B. S. Stillwell |
| 6 | Australian Grand Prix | Caversham | Western Australia | 18 November[7] | Bruce McLaren | Cooper T62Coventry Climax | Bruce McLaren[7] |
Championship points were awarded on a 12-7-5-3-2-1 basis for the six best placed Australian license holders.[1][8] Each driver could count his/her results from the Australian Grand Prix plus the best four results from the remaining races.[4] Ties in the award were determined by the relevant drivers placings in the Australian Grand Prix.[1][9]
| Position[4] | Driver[4] | Car[4] | Entrant[4] | Lon.[4] | Bat.[4] | Low.[4] | San.[4] | Mal.[4] | Cav.[4] | Total[4] |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Bib Stillwell | Cooper T53Coventry Climax FPF | B. S. Stillwell | 7 | 12 | - | 7 | 12 | 7 | 45 |
| 2 | John Youl | Cooper T51Coventry Climax FPF Cooper T55Coventry Climax FPF | Scuderia Veloce | 2 | - | - | - | 7 | 12 | 21 |
| 3 | Bill Patterson | Cooper T51Coventry Climax FPF | Bill Patterson Motors | 3 | 5 | - | 5 | - | 5 | 18 |
| 4 | Greg Cusack | Cooper T51Coventry Climax FPF | Scuderia Veloce | - | 3 | 12 | 3 | - | - | 18 |
| 5 | David McKay | Cooper T53Coventry Climax FPF | Scuderia Veloce | 5 | 7 | - | - | 5 | - | 17 |
| 6 | Lex Davison | Cooper T53Coventry Climax FPF | Ecurie Australie | 1 | - | 12 | - | - | 13 | |
| 7 | Jack Brabham | Cooper T55Coventry Climax FPF | Ecurie Vitesse[5] | 12 | - | - | - | - | - | 12 |
| 8 | Bryan Thomson | Cooper T51Coventry Climax FPFS/C | Ecurie Shepparton | - | - | 7 | 2 | - | - | 9 |
| 9 | Tom Ross | Lotus 20Ford | T. Ross | - | - | 5 | - | - | - | 5 |
| 10 | Arnold Glass | BRM P48Buick | Capitol Motors Pty Ltd | - | - | - | - | - | 3 | 3 |
| 11 | Clive Nolan | Lotus 20Ford | Clive Nolan Motors | - | - | 3 | - | - | - | 3 |
| = | Andy Brown | Elfin FJFord | Autocourse Elfin | - | - | - | - | 3 | - | 3 |
| 13 | Syd Negus | Cooper T20Repco Holden | Syd Negus | - | - | - | - | - | 2 | 2 |
| 14 | Alwyn Rose | Dalro Jaguar Mk II | A. Rose | - | 2 | - | - | - | - | 2 |
| = | Roy Morris | Elfin FJClimax Climax FWA | R. Morris | - | - | 2 | - | - | - | 2 |
| = | Bill Pile | Cooper Mk. VClimax Climax FWA | W. Pile | - | - | - | - | 2 | - | 2 |
| 17 | Ted Edwards | TS Special | E. Edwards | - | - | - | - | - | 1 | 1 |
| 18 | Ron Marshall | Cooper T51 (Replica)Coventry Climax FPF | R. Marshall | 1 | - | - | - | - | - | 1 |
| = | Ron Halpin | Gremlin FJFord | Gold Coast Auto | - | - | 1 | - | - | - | 1 |
| = | Garrie Cooper | Elfin FJFord | Elfin Sports Cars | - | - | - | - | 1 | - | 1 |
